This clinic runs alongside the Elevate Girls program and is designed specifically for goalies, run by Amanda Leveille (UofM, PWHL) and Josh Chambers, L.P.C. (OHL, NHL) – two coaches who bring elite-level goalie expertise and mental performance training to the same ice.

Every session combines technical goalie skill work with the mental fitness tools that matter most at the position: reading play before it develops, managing the emotional weight the loneliest role on the ice, and resetting fast under pressure.Being a goalie is a different psychological job than being a skater. This clinic trains both sides of it.

What You’ll Learn

  • Positioning and Angles: Learn to control your crease and cut down shots through smart positioning rather than pure athleticism.
  • Efficient Mechanics: Develop clean, efficient save mechanics that hold up at higher speeds and skill levels.
  • Rebound Control: Make intentional decisions about where the puck goes after saves.
  • Reading the Play: Anticipate passes, shots, and screens before they happen.
  • Resetting After a Goal: Build the mental habits to stay focused and compete hard after a mistake.
  • Composure Under Pressure: Develop the focus and emotional control that separates good goalies from great ones.

About the Coach
Amanda Leveille is one of the most decorated goaltenders in women's hockey history.

She won three NCAA national championships at the University of Minnesota, holds the PHF all-time records for wins and shutouts, and is a two-time Isobel Cup champion. After retiring from professional play in 2024, she transitioned full-time into coaching — and she's been doing it in Minnesota ever since. She brings elite technical goalie development and a deep understanding of the mental side of the position to every session.

About the Coach
I'm Josh Chambers. I'm a licensed therapist with OHL and NHL experience, and I believe much of today's athletic development is outdated.

To prepare for training camp with the Red Wings, I hired a skate doctor and experienced firsthand the power of precise, individualized training. I had spent countless hours at power skating clinics over the years, but it was those focused, personalized sessions that made a real difference. That experience transformed how I think about training.

Then there was the mental side—something I had no training in but desperately needed. Four games after training camp, a slapshot to the face fractured my skull. The mental toll during recovery was significant and gave me a new perspective on the psychological side of development.

When I began coaching my daughter, I saw a clear lack of both innovative skills training and mental fitness in hockey development. That’s why I started Headspace Hockey: to combine cutting-edge skills training with sports psychology, helping build confident, resilient athletes.
